Macil Marie Reed, 87, of Dunbar, passed away Monday, July 27, 2009, at home after a short illness.
Macil was born October 7, 1921 in Putnam County. She was the daughter of the late Ammon Reed and Dora King Reed Jeffries. Also preceding her in death were her son Michael Lee Garnes, brothers, O'Dell Reed and Robert Samples, sisters, Bethelene Lunsford, Marietta Hartley, Ruby Underwood and Erma Nicholas.
Macil was a homemaker and lived most of her life in Putnam County. After the death of her son, she moved to Dunbar in 1999 where she made many new friends. She was employed by the old Dunbar Flint Glass Co. in the early 1940's. She will be deeply missed by her family and friends.
